Ticket #— Floor 9 Opening Prep, Brindlemoor House

Hi facilities folks, Floor 9 opens to staff next Monday and we need a few things squared away before then. Lift access is live, but the two side doors by the kitchenette are still on the old lock config — please reprogram them before Friday. Also, signage for the quiet rooms hasn't arrived, so pop up the temporary printed ones for now. Until the badge readers sync, the interim door code for Floor 9 is below.

door code, bajop-bajog: bdg-DSWAC-43621

Leadership Review Briefing — Logistics Switch

Quick heads-up for branch managers ahead of the review: we're moving from Hartwell Carriers to Fenlode Freight starting next quarter. Fenlode offers better rural coverage around Millbeck and roughly ten percent lower per-pallet rates. Expect a bumpy first fortnight—keep spare stock buffers up. Raise routing issues with your regional lead early. The thinking behind the change is summarised below.

internal memo for faweg-tafog: Only 7 of the 100 pilot accounts renewed Quenael, so a churn review is set for April 15.

### Step 4: Switch the firmware update channel

Before promoting the Orbinet gateway build, move all staging devices from the `beta` channel to the new `stable-rollout` channel. Do this gradually: migrate the canary cohort first, wait one full check-in cycle, and confirm that no device reports a checksum mismatch. Only then flip the fleet-wide flag. Note that the channel resolver caches aggressively, so a stale entry can delay rollout by hours. Once the cohort is verified, apply the channel service configuration exactly as follows.

settings of fafog-haduf:
ZORIX_PIN=4648
ZORIX_METRICS_HOST=metrics.zorix.paliqsys.corp
ZORIX_LOG_LEVEL=info
ZORIX_TENANT=druix